Service Warranty Size Contrast
A thorough comparison of service warranty sizes exposes significant differences in between pre-owned and new engine alternatives. New engines commonly include considerable warranties, usually ranging from 3 to 5 years or more, reflecting the manufacturer's self-confidence in their product's durability and dependability. This substantial coverage gives comfort for customers, as it protects against prospective defects and failings. On the other hand, utilized engines typically offer shorter service warranties, typically limited to a few months or a details mileage limit. This inconsistency highlights the inherent risks related to buying secondhand elements, as the likelihood of deterioration increases with age. Possible buyers have to evaluate the benefits of warranty size when determining in between brand-new and used engine options.

Documents of Solution Records
Solution records act as a considerable indication of an engine's maintenance history and integrity. They offer thorough understandings right into the engine's past care, consisting of routine maintenance, repairs, and any significant concerns came across. A detailed documentation collection can disclose patterns that suggest whether an engine has been well-kept or neglected. Secret aspects to review in solution records consist of oil adjustment regularity, substitute of essential parts, and any kind of documented repair work. In addition, records ought to ideally originate from trusted resources, such as authorized solution centers, to boost integrity. Very carefully analyzing these papers allows possible purchasers to make enlightened decisions, ultimately influencing the engine's durability and performance. This facet is crucial in establishing whether to select a brand-new or utilized engine alternative.
